How Does a Harness Improve Safety for Little Dogs?

A harness is essential for ensuring the safety and comfort of little dogs during walks and other activities.

  • Prevents Neck Injuries: Harnesses distribute pressure evenly across the dog’s chest and back, reducing the risk of injury to the neck and throat, which can occur with traditional collars.
  • Better Control: A harness allows for improved control over smaller dogs, which can be more prone to pulling or darting unexpectedly, providing owners with a secure grip.
  • Enhanced Comfort: Many harnesses are designed with padded materials that prevent chafing and discomfort, making walks more enjoyable for little dogs.
  • Escape Prevention: High-quality harnesses often feature secure fastening systems that reduce the risk of a little dog slipping out, especially during exciting moments.
  • Reflective Features: Some harnesses come with reflective strips, enhancing visibility during low-light conditions, which is critical for the safety of small dogs during evening walks.

Prevents Neck Injuries: Harnesses distribute pressure evenly across the dog’s chest and back, which is particularly important for little dogs whose tracheas can be easily damaged by pulling on a collar. By avoiding direct pressure on the neck, harnesses help prevent serious injuries that can lead to long-term health issues.

Better Control: With a harness, dog owners can have a firmer grip on their pet, which is vital for small breeds that might be more energetic or skittish. This level of control helps manage sudden movements or distractions, making walks safer for both the dog and the owner.

Enhanced Comfort: Many harnesses are made with padded straps and breathable materials, ensuring that small dogs remain comfortable during walks. This comfort can also help reduce anxiety, allowing little dogs to enjoy their outdoor adventures without the risk of discomfort or distress.

Escape Prevention: A well-fitted harness is designed to be secure, reducing the likelihood of a little dog slipping out during an exciting moment, such as encountering other dogs or loud noises. This feature is crucial for safety, as it prevents dogs from running into potentially dangerous situations.

Reflective Features: Harnesses equipped with reflective materials are beneficial for evening or early morning walks, increasing visibility to passing vehicles and pedestrians. This added safety feature ensures that little dogs remain visible in low-light conditions, reducing the risk of accidents.

Why Is Comfort Important for Small Dogs When Choosing a Harness?

According to the American Kennel Club, a harness that fits properly and provides comfort can prevent anxiety and encourage positive behavior during walks and outdoor activities. Harnesses that are too tight or poorly designed can cause chafing, discomfort, and restrict movement, leading to a negative experience for the dog.

The underlying mechanism behind this importance lies in the physical structure of small dogs. They often have more delicate frames and sensitive skin compared to larger breeds, making them more susceptible to discomfort caused by ill-fitting equipment. When a harness is comfortable, it distributes pressure evenly across the dog’s body, reducing the risk of injury and allowing for natural movement. This promotes confidence and reduces stress, which are essential for a happy and healthy pet. Additionally, comfortable harnesses can foster a positive association with being leashed, making walks more enjoyable for both the dog and the owner.

What Are the Most Recommended Types of Harnesses for Little Dogs?

The best harnesses for little dogs combine comfort, safety, and ease of use.

  • Step-in Harness: This type allows dogs to simply step into the harness, which is then secured at the back. It is easy to put on and take off, making it ideal for little dogs who may dislike traditional over-the-head harnesses.
  • Vest Harness: A vest harness covers more of the dog’s body and distributes pressure evenly across the chest. This type is particularly beneficial for small dogs as it provides extra support and prevents choking during walks.
  • No-Pull Harness: Designed to discourage pulling behavior, this harness typically features a front clip that redirects the dog’s movement. This can be especially useful for little dogs that may be prone to pulling on the leash during walks.
  • Adjustable Harness: These harnesses come with multiple adjustment points, allowing for a custom fit. This is crucial for little dogs, as a snug fit ensures safety and comfort while preventing escape.
  • Reflective Harness: Ideal for walks during low-light conditions, reflective harnesses come with materials that enhance visibility. This added safety feature is important for little dogs, making them more visible to drivers and other pedestrians.

How Do You Determine the Right Size Harness for Your Little Dog?

Choosing the right size harness for your little dog involves several key considerations:

  • Measure Your Dog’s Girth: Use a flexible measuring tape to measure around the widest part of your dog’s chest, just behind the front legs. This measurement is crucial as it helps you select a harness that fits snugly without being too tight or too loose.
  • Check the Weight Guidelines: Most harnesses come with weight guidelines provided by the manufacturer. Ensure that your dog’s weight falls within the recommended range for the harness size to ensure proper fit and comfort.
  • Consider the Breed and Body Shape: Different breeds can have varying body shapes even at similar weights, so take into account your dog’s specific build. For example, a Dachshund might need a different style than a Chihuahua, even if they weigh the same.
  • Look for Adjustable Features: Harnesses with adjustable straps can accommodate growth and provide a better fit. This feature is particularly important for puppies, who may still be growing and changing shape.
  • Read Reviews and Product Descriptions: Customer reviews can provide insight into how a harness fits real dogs. Look for feedback specific to small dogs to gauge whether others have had success with the harness you are considering.
  • Try It On: If possible, try the harness on your dog before purchasing. It should allow for a comfortable range of movement while ensuring it does not slip off or restrict your dog’s breathing.

What Mistakes Should You Avoid When Choosing a Harness for Your Small Dog?

When selecting the best harness for a little dog, it’s essential to avoid common mistakes that can affect comfort and safety.

  • Choosing the Wrong Size: A harness that is too loose can slip off and cause your dog to escape, while one that is too tight can restrict movement and cause injury. Always measure your dog’s girth and consult the manufacturer’s sizing chart to ensure a proper fit.
  • Ignoring Material Quality: Low-quality materials can lead to wear and tear, and may not provide adequate support or comfort. Opt for harnesses made from durable, breathable fabrics that are designed for small breeds to ensure longevity and comfort.
  • Neglecting Design Features: Some harness designs can put pressure on a dog’s throat, which is especially concerning for small breeds. Look for harnesses with a front-clip design or padded straps that distribute pressure evenly and promote better control during walks.
  • Overlooking Adjustability: Harnesses that lack adjustability can lead to improper fit as your dog grows or changes shape. Select a harness with adjustable straps to accommodate changes and ensure a snug yet comfortable fit at all times.
  • Disregarding Ease of Use: A harness that is difficult to put on or take off can lead to frustration for both you and your dog. Choose a design that is easy to use, with quick-release buckles or step-in features that allow you to outfit your dog quickly and efficiently.
  • Failing to Consider Your Dog’s Activity Level: Different harnesses are suited for different activities, whether it’s casual walks, running, or hiking. Consider your dog’s lifestyle and select a harness that provides sufficient support and comfort for the intended use.
